Browse editions

Current edition

546 pages first pub 2022 (editions)

fiction fantasy historical challenging dark emotional medium-paced
Other editions (142)
Expand filter menu Filter editions

542 pages first pub 2022 (editions)

fiction fantasy historical challenging dark emotional medium-paced

548 pages first pub 2022 (editions)

fiction fantasy historical challenging dark emotional medium-paced

656 pages first pub 2022 (editions) user-added

fiction fantasy historical challenging dark emotional medium-paced

Babel

R.F. Kuang

22 hours, 56 minutes first pub 2022 (editions)

fiction fantasy historical challenging dark emotional medium-paced

624 pages first pub 2022 (editions)

fiction fantasy historical challenging dark emotional medium-paced

654 pages first pub 2022 (editions)

fiction fantasy historical challenging dark emotional medium-paced

763 pages first pub 2022 (editions)

fiction fantasy historical challenging dark emotional medium-paced

600 pages first pub 2022 (editions)

fiction fantasy historical challenging dark emotional medium-paced

560 pages first pub 2022 (editions)

fiction fantasy historical challenging dark emotional medium-paced

526 pages first pub 2022 (editions) user-added

fiction fantasy historical challenging dark emotional medium-paced